I'm working on a second degree so I've pretty seen it all. Look, FIU is just like any other school—your success will depend on you, and you alone. Professors are hit or miss; some are truly passionate about teaching, others are more interested in their side projects and act annoyed that they even have to teach. Get to know other students in your major and find out which professors are the best. If a bad professor can't be avoided, suck it up—that's life! We don't always get to work with people we like. Do the best you can, meet your deadlines, and before you know it you will be on to your next semester. The world is not going to end if you get a C. I don't recommend that you live on campus, as others have said they are dead starting on Fridays. If you are a serious student, the constant activities in the dorms will likely get on your nerves. I mainly go to the BBC campus, which is far more manageable that the MMC campus. My only gripe with the commute to BBC is the charter school right next door, traffic can get ugly when parents are picking up or dropping off their kids. Plus there is the school zone to contend with from time to time. Some students are jerks, some are friendly. Again, that's life. My biggest complaint with FIU is the administrative staff, in a word: RUDE. Everyone from Financial Aid, Registrar, Admissions, etc. need a lesson in civility. I don't pay thousands of dollars a year to get mistreated. Constant runaround, conflicting information, you name it I've been through it. If you want something done properly, do it yourself, don't depend on other people. Overall, FIU isn't a bad university—it just needs a little polish. Its the best public school option in South Florida and truly can be a rewarding experience if you make the effort.
